From 35124acd1973725843530d2dd8b805f717fec581 Mon Sep 17 00:00:00 2001 From: Johnny Matthews Date: Mon, 29 Nov 2021 13:04:25 -0600 Subject: Geometry Nodes: Domain Size Node The Domain Size node has a single geometry input and a selection for the component type. Based on the component chosen, outputs containing single values for the related domains are shown.
